w3seek
Developer
Posts: 144
Joined: Tue Nov 23, 2004 12:12 am

Post by w3seek »

I personally expect 0.3.0 not before mid to end of january, maybe there'll be a 0.2.6 release towards the end of december (with not really working/very unstable networking). There's nothing official though. The goal for 0.3.0 however is networking.
